sound/pci/ac97/ac97_patch.c +38 −0 Original line number Diff line number Diff line Loading @@ -2872,3 +2872,41 @@ int patch_lm4550(struct snd_ac97 *ac97) ac97->res_table = lm4550_restbl; return 0; } /* * UCB1400 codec (http://www.semiconductors.philips.com/acrobat_download/datasheets/UCB1400-02.pdf) */ static const struct snd_kcontrol_new snd_ac97_controls_ucb1400[] = { /* enable/disable headphone driver which allows direct connection to stereo headphone without the use of external DC blocking capacitors */ AC97_SINGLE("Headphone Driver", 0x6a, 6, 1, 0), /* Filter used to compensate the DC offset is added in the ADC to remove idle tones from the audio band. */ AC97_SINGLE("DC Filter", 0x6a, 4, 1, 0), /* Control smart-low-power mode feature. Allows automatic power down of unused blocks in the ADC analog front end and the PLL. */ AC97_SINGLE("Smart Low Power Mode", 0x6c, 4, 3, 0), }; static int patch_ucb1400_specific(struct snd_ac97 * ac97) { int idx, err; for (idx = 0; idx < ARRAY_SIZE(snd_ac97_controls_ucb1400); idx++) if ((err = snd_ctl_add(ac97->bus->card, snd_ctl_new1(&snd_ac97_controls_ucb1400[idx], ac97))) < 0) return err; return 0; } static struct snd_ac97_build_ops patch_ucb1400_ops = { .build_specific = patch_ucb1400_specific, }; int patch_ucb1400(struct snd_ac97 * ac97) { ac97->build_ops = &patch_ucb1400_ops; /* enable headphone driver and smart low power mode by default */ snd_ac97_write(ac97, 0x6a, 0x0050); snd_ac97_write(ac97, 0x6c, 0x0030); return 0; }
